Small skatepark with quarter pipe, flatbank, fun box, couple of rails, benches. Metal with tarmac floor-unfortunately we have a kiddie problem and little children use it as a playground.

Solihull Council are building a skateboard area in the new park in Balsall Common, the entrance is in Lavender Hall Lane. It is hoped to be completed in October
